Today, on September 2, Tallinn’s partner city Odesa celebrates its City Day, which is linked to the city’s official founding in 1794. The date is marked with festive events, concerts, and cultural programs.
The Tallinn Electoral Committee will continue accepting notices of registration for electoral alliances until 4 September, and candidate applications for the City Council and district councils until 9 September at 18:00.
Today, the SA Tallinna Haigla Arendus signed a contract with the joint bidders Osaühing Sirkel ja Mall and INDUSTRIA PROJECT Sp. z o.o. to start preparing the main design project for the future Tallinn Hospital medical campus.
To vote in the Tallinn City Council elections, a voter’s official address in the population register must be in Tallinn no later than 19 September 2025. The voter lists are compiled based on the population register data as of that date.
